WIN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

444 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Windstream Holdings Inc (WIN)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$2.68B — down 45% from $4.91B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 66 funds closed out of WIN and 48 opened new positions — a net loss of 18 holders — while 149 trimmed existing stakes and 166 added.

The largest buyer was Advisors Asset Management, adding an estimated $39.7M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$29.7M.
